Radeon Vega 8 vs Radeon 660M specs and performance

For gaming, the Radeon Vega 8 graphics card is better than the Radeon 660M in our tests.

The Radeon 660M has a significantly higher core clock speed. This is the frequency at which the graphics core is running at. While not necessarily an indicator of overall performance, this metric can be useful when comparing two GPUs based on the same architecture. Despite this, the Radeon Vega 8 has a slightly higher boost clock speed: the maximum frequency the chip can reach if power delivery and thermals allow.

In addition, the Radeon 660M has a significantly lower TDP at 15 W when compared to the Radeon Vega 8 at 45 W. Heat output doesn't match power consumption directly but, it's a good estimate.

In terms of raw gaming performance in our GPU benchmark, the Radeon Vega 8 is better than the Radeon 660M.
